• 최초 작성일: 2008-04-13
  • 최종 수정일: 2008-04-16
  • 조회수: 106,774 회
  • 작성자: 엑셀러 권현욱
  • 강의 제목: 중간값이 생략된 차트 만들기

엑셀러 권현욱

들어가기 전에

빅터 프랭클이 쓴 <죽음의 수용소에서>에 나오는 글입니다.

성공을 목표로 삼지 말라.
성공을 목표로 삼고, 그것을 표적으로 하면 할수록 더욱 멀어질 뿐이다.
성공은 행복과 마찬가지로 찾을 수 있는 것이 아니라 찾아오는 것이다.

"도대체 강좌를 언제 올릴거냐?"는 여러분의 열화와 같은 질타(말 되나?)에 힘입어 실로 오래간만에 강의를 재개합니다. 기존처럼 엑셀 파일(.zip)로만 만들어 올리면 성의가 덜한 것도 같고, 또 Excel 2007 강의도 뜸했던 것 같아서 포맷을 조금 바꾸어 보았습니다.



세로 막대형 차트를 작성하는데 일부 데이터 값이 지나치게 크다면(예를 들어 과목별 성적표에 총점이 포함된 경우), 나머지 막대들이 바닥에 붙어서 표시되므로 눈에 잘 들어오지 않습니다. 이런 경우에는 중간값을 생략한 차트 '중간값 생략 차트'라고 명명함를 만들면 한결 알아보기 쉽습니다.

완성 예

바로 아래와 같은 형태가 그런 경우지요.

로딩 중...

중간 값 생략 차트

사실 이와 관련된 질문은 잊을 만하면 한번씩 질문을 받기 때문에 잊으려 해도 그럴 수 없는 질문 중 하나입니다. 아주 오래 전에 "빛은 어둠을 만들고 어둠은 빛을 드러냅니다"라는 아주 고차원적인 제목(하지만 해결 방법에 있어서는 전혀 그렇지 못했던)의 VBA 강의를 통해 한 가지 방법을 소개해 드린 적도 있었습니다.

이번 시간에는 이런 번거로운 방법 말고 좀 더 간단하게 해결해 보겠습니다. 물론 Excel 강의이므로 VBA는 한 줄도 사용하지 않습니다.

기본 데이터 준비

1. 예제 파일의 A3:B9 영역을 이용하여 [세로 막대형] 차트를 작성합니다. 설화수 수치가 너무 커서 나머지 브랜드와 제대로 비교하기 어렵습니다.

참고로 예제에서 사용한 데이터는 dummy 데이터입니다.

로딩 중...

2. 예제 파일의 C4 셀에 다음 수식을 입력하고 수식을 아래로 복사합니다. B4 셀의 값이 1억 이상이면 해당 셀 값을 5로 나눈 결과값을 표시하고, 그렇지 않으면 있는 값을 그대로 보여주라는 의미입니다.

=IF(B4>=100000000, B4/5, B4)

그런데 왜 하필이면 5로 나누었을까요? 그것은 비밀...이 아니고 일종의 '경험치'랍니다. 꼭 5로 나눌 필요는 없으며, 막대의 길이가 적당해 질 때까지 변경해 가면 됩니다. 데이터 특성에 따라 2나 3이 될 수도, 혹은 10이 될 수도 있습니다.

로딩 중...

차트 계열 수정

1. 원본 데이터의 범위를 수정합니다. 차트의 그림 영역을 마우스 오른쪽 버튼으로 클릭하고 [데이터 선택] 메뉴를 클릭합니다. 엑셀 2007 이번 버전에서는 [원본 데이터] 메뉴입니다.

로딩 중...

2. [데이터 원본 선택] 대화상자에서 [범례 항목(계열)] 부분의 [편집] 버튼을 클릭합니다. 이전 버전이라면 [원본 데이터] 대화상자의 [값] 항목을 수정하면 됩니다(Exceller의 PC에는 엑셀 2007 버전만 설치되어 있는 관계로 앞으로 설명드리는 단계부터는 여러분 PC에 설치된 엑셀 버전의 메뉴를 잘 참고해서 따라오세요 ^^).

로딩 중...

3. [계열 편집] 대화상자가 나타나면 [계열 값]을 앞에서 추가해 준 C4:C9 영역으로 변경하고 [확인] 버튼을 클릭합니다. [데이터 원본 선택] 대화상자로 돌아오면 [확인] 버튼을 누릅니다.

로딩 중...

4. 여기까지 완료되면 차트 형태가 다음과 같이 변경됩니다. 몇 가지 문제가 눈에 띄긴 하지만 막대의 길이가 상향평준화 되었군요.

로딩 중...

5. 차트의 기본 설정 값을 몇 가지 변경해야 합니다. 세로 축은 의미가 없으므로 미련 없이 제거합니다. '설화수' 계열의 데이터 레이블도 원래 데이터와 연결해 주어야겠군요. 차트의 데이터 레이블을 클릭하면 전체 레이블이 선택되고 '설화수' 레이블을 한 번 더 클릭하면 '설화수' 레이블만 선택됩니다. 수식 입력줄에 '='를 입력하고, B4 셀을 마우스로 클릭한 다음 ENTER 키를 누릅니다.

로딩 중...

6. 이제 거의 끝났습니다. 중간값이 생략되었음을 표시하기 위한 물결 모양을 차트에 삽입하기만 하면 됩니다. [삽입] 탭 - [일러스트레이션] 그룹 [도형] 명령을 클릭합니다. [곡선] 아이콘을 선택한 다음 워크시트에 적당한 형태의 곡선을 하나 그립니다. 선의 색상과 두께를 적당히 지정하여 물결 모양처럼 보이도록 합니다.

로딩 중...

한동안 열심히 내공을 다졌으니 앞으로는 업로드 주기가 조금 빨라지지 않을까 조심스레 기대해 봅니다. 폭발적인 응원으로 게시판이나 방명록을 도배해 주시면 그 주기가 확 줄어들 수도 있다는 소문도 있습니다. ^^